On Nov 3, 2006, at 3:09 AM, Negoita, Cristian wrote:

Issue is, this simplified syntax is decisive in using Jess further in the project. Jess 6 is used already, but, now, in another part of the project there is the need to change/generate rules at runtime, which would be much simpler with the new syntax.

Here we have to know when these parenthesized expressions will be supported (time und release von Jess), so we can match it with our release timeframe.


It would be a feature in Jess 7.1, not 8.0, so it's a near-term feature. I don't have a release date yet, but I would expect it to be in Q1 2007.

Personally, if I was writing code to generate rules, I'd be doing it in JessML (Jess's new XML format). Rules can be translated easily between the two representations, and it's much easier to generate XML programmatically.
